What are the responsibilities and job description for the Nurse Practitioner position at Bigfork Valley?
Bigfork Valley is seeking a Nurse Practitioner to work in our Specialty Clinic. The Nurse Practitioner is responsible for managing the care of patients in the area of orthopedics and wound care.
The NP is responsible for managing the care of patients who suffer from a range of musculoskeletal conditions, including administering treatments, prescribing medications, analyzing X-rays, conducting physical exams, and providing pre and post-operation care. The NP is also responsible for the implementation of skin/wound care procedures and management. The NP works closely with physicians and nursing staff to coordinate patients’ care.
The NP shall provide care under the guidelines established by the policies and procedures of Bigfork Valley and is responsible for providing continuity of patient care through patient education, evaluation, treatment, and follow-up planning.
Services provided by the NP at Bigfork Valley must be in accordance with the laws of the State of Minnesota governing such services and the Bigfork Valley Medical Staff Bylaws. The NP is governed by the Minnesota State Board of Nursing. The scope of the NP’s practice will be determined by the Standard Scope of Practice as approved by the Minnesota State Board of Nursing.
Currently licensed as an Advanced Practice Nurse Practitioner in the state of Minnesota. Three to five years of progressive clinical nursing experience in orthopedics.
Obtains and maintains appropriate certification for practice areas in orthopedics and wound care.
